Capacity Crowd says Farewell to Gardners

A capacity crowd of 400 people from across our Convention gathered at Atlantic Baptist University on Friday night, September 21st to say thank you and farewell to Dr. Harry Gardner and his wife Gail. Dr. Gardner is completing 12 years of service as Executive Minister and a total of 21 years as a member of our Convention’s staff.
The evening included a delicious meal, tributes from leaders from across our Convention, and beautiful music from harpist Dorothy Brzezicki and fiddler Stephanie Mainville. Gail was presented with a stunning bouquet of flowers, Harry was given an ipod, and the couple was presented with a grandfather clock for their new home in the Annapolis Valley of Nova Scotia.
In his remarks at the end of the evening, Harry expressed that he was overwhelmed at the show of appreciation and noted with special joy the presence of leaders from the African United Baptist Association. He thanked those present for the trust they had placed in him as a leader over the past two decades and that he looked forward to many more years of fellowship and friendship in his new role as President of the Convention’s seminary, Acadia Divinity College.
